WHAT WE FOUND
The claim is TRUE because a republic is widely defined as a form of representative democracy . While some distinctions exist between a pure democracy and a pure republic , modern political terminology uses the terms interchangeably to describe governments where citizens vote for their leaders . In a republic, the people hold ultimate power and elect representatives to pass laws on their behalf . Official government materials from USCIS explicitly state that the United States is a representative democracy . Furthermore, scholars and government entities describe the American system as a democratic republic, noting that it has historically functioned as both . Although the word democracy does not appear in the Constitution, the document established a federal system of representative government . While some commentators argue the systems are distinct, the two concepts overlap in their reliance on the political power of the citizenry .
